Accessing public records in Wewoka, OK
Wewoka is incorporated with a local city government which will contain some public records. But most public records are held by Seminole County court and the county clerk's office. Local law enforcement agencies will also hold records related to criminal offenses. These agencies are Seminole County Sheriff's Office and Wewoka Police Department.
The below state agencies will also hold records for Wewoka residents.
Oklahoma State Department of Health: Provides access to vital records such as birth certificates, death certificates, marriage certificates, and divorce records.
Oklahoma Department of Corrections: Provides access to records related to incarcerated individuals, including inmate records and prison information.
Oklahoma State Department of Education: Offers access to educational records, including information on schools, districts, and educational statistics.
Oklahoma Department of Public Safety: Manages records related to driver's licenses, vehicle registrations, and driving records.
Oklahoma Secretary of State: Maintains records related to business entities, including corporate filings, trademarks, and trade names.
In addition, Seminole State College. may contain records for residents of Wewoka.
